I Spy an Alphabet in Art, by Lucy Micklethwait On each page, children hunt for an object in famous artwork that begins with a particular letter. The Handmade Alphabet, by Laura Rankin This is a beautifully illustrated book with a hand holding an object that begins with each letter while also forming that letter with American Sign Language.
